The Ipsy theme for September is “Face Fashion.” Ipsy is a monthly beauty subscription – get 5 items in a cute bag for $10 a month! It’s the most popular subscription box (even though it’s a bag) with over 1.3 million subscribers and 100k new ones monthly. GlamGlow FlashMud Brightening Treatment ($20.29) I had to totally calculate that twice but yes, this is around one third the size of the full size, which is $69. Pricey! This is a fast acting brightening and tone evening mask. I am really excited to try it out and test the results – if it helps even my skin tone I would totally purchase the full size. I think this about 3 applications so it’s a nice trial to see if their claims hold true.  And tons of value! I hit the jackpot.

Temptu Highlighter in Champagne Shimmer ($6.88) I love this product! You can use it straight for highlighting or mix it in with foundation for a subtle glow. Even though this isn’t full size, this teeny bottle lasts me forever! I didn’t take a photo of the card that comes with this, but it mentioned the Temptu makeup airbrush system. Pixi by Petra Mini Brow Trio Shades Shades of Brow ($3?) This is a teensy weensy brow trio and I was definitely unimpressed by the size mostly because it’s a little hard to maneuver in there.  Please let me know what you think of yours in the comments – since I just got a brand new full size brow item I’m passing this one on.

City Color City Chic Lipstick in One Night Stand ($5)  This is a fun color! It’s somewhat of a drugstore brand but that’s ok. You should expect a mix of indie, drugstore, and sometimes high end items in your bag.

This was a good bag – but as I mentioned above with all that money coming in I really am expecting some changes to the subscription for the better. My bag had around a $37 value and the price of the subscription was worth it for the GlamGlow alone. I typically do not use every item that comes in my bags but the value is good enough that it doesn’t seem to matter!
